Transaction dd7bcab2922a4d0860a067b2998573d56fa252e1b1366698a31a7b3ea0b76031
1 Input
1 Output
-
dd7bcab2922a4d0860a067b2998573d56fa252e1b1366698a31a7b3ea0b76031:0
- value
- 609133
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63de4e37a220bf94f85c53ac87d12184abd0ec8d OP_EQUAL
- address
- 3Ao58bRtVKodLqpiqL8Zhuza8DirxLsuoa